首页 > 快讯 > 甄选问答 >

IF函数的用法是什么如何根据条件执行不同操作

2025-12-18 02:54:48

问题描述:

IF函数的用法是什么如何根据条件执行不同操作,求解答求解答,重要的事说两遍!

最佳答案

推荐答案

2025-12-18 02:54:48

IF函数的用法是什么如何根据条件执行不同操作】在Excel或类似电子表格软件中,IF函数是最常用、最基础的逻辑函数之一。它的主要作用是根据设定的条件判断真假,并返回不同的结果。通过IF函数,用户可以实现条件判断、数据筛选、自动分类等操作,大大提升工作效率。

以下是对IF函数的总结性说明,结合实际应用场景进行分析,并以表格形式展示其基本结构和使用方式。

一、IF函数的基本结构

IF函数的语法如下:

```

=IF(条件, 条件为真时的结果, 条件为假时的结果)

```

- 条件:一个逻辑表达式,用于判断是否成立。

- 条件为真时的结果:当条件成立时返回的值或计算结果。

- 条件为假时的结果:当条件不成立时返回的值或计算结果。

二、IF函数的使用场景

场景 示例 说明
成绩判断 `=IF(A1>=60,"及格","不及格")` 判断A1单元格中的成绩是否及格
奖金发放 `=IF(B2>10000,"有奖金","无奖金")` 根据销售额决定是否有奖金
分类统计 `=IF(C3="男","男性","女性")` 对性别进行分类显示
销售折扣 `=IF(D4>5000,D40.9,D4)` 超过5000元给予9折优惠

三、IF函数的进阶应用

IF函数还可以与其他函数结合使用,如AND、OR、NOT等,实现更复杂的条件判断。

1. 使用AND组合多个条件

```

=IF(AND(A1>60, B1>70), "通过", "未通过")

```

- 只有当A1>60且B1>70时,才返回“通过”。

2. 使用OR满足任一条件

```

=IF(OR(A1="A", A1="B"), "优秀", "一般")

```

- 当A1为“A”或“B”时,返回“优秀”。

3. 嵌套IF函数

```

=IF(A1>90, "优秀", IF(A1>80, "良好", "及格"))

```

- 用于多级评分系统,如90分以上为优秀,80-89为良好,60-79为及格。

四、IF函数的注意事项

注意事项 说明
条件必须是逻辑值 如TRUE/FALSE或比较运算符(>、<、=)
结果可为数值、文本、公式等 但需保持一致性
避免过多嵌套 嵌套太多会降低可读性和效率
大小写敏感 Excel中的文本比较是区分大小写的

五、总结

IF函数是一种强大的逻辑判断工具,适用于各种需要根据条件返回不同结果的场景。掌握其基本用法并灵活运用,能够显著提高数据处理和分析的效率。对于初学者来说,从简单的条件判断开始,逐步尝试嵌套和组合逻辑,是学习IF函数的有效路径。

函数名称 功能 应用场景
IF函数 根据条件返回不同结果 成绩判断、分类、条件筛选等
AND函数 检查多个条件是否同时为真 多条件判断
OR函数 检查多个条件是否至少有一个为真 多选项选择
NOT函数 反转逻辑值 简化条件判断

通过合理使用IF函数,可以让电子表格更加智能化和自动化,真正实现“按条件执行操作”的目标。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。